Abstract
According to one embodiment, a display device includes a first substrate including an insulating substrate, a color filter layer located above the insulating substrate, a signal line located between the insulating substrate and the color filter layer, a metal line located above the color filter layer, a first light-shielding layer stacked on the metal line, a common electrode located above the first light-shielding layer, a pixel electrode opposed to the common electrode, a second substrate opposed to the first substrate, and a liquid crystal layer held between the first substrate and the second substrate.

8. A display device comprising:
-
a display area; a non-display area surrounding the display area; a relay electrode located in the non-display area; a first interlayer insulating film located above the relay electrode; a metal line extending above the first interlayer insulating film in the display area and the non-display area; a second interlayer insulating film located above the first interlayer insulating film and the metal line; and a common electrode extending above the second interlayer insulating film the display area and the non-display area, the first interlayer isolating film including a contact hole penetrated to the relay electrode, the metal line and the common electrode being in contact with the relay electrode at the contact hole. - View Dependent Claims (9, 10, 11, 12, 13, 14)

15. A display device comprising:
-
a first substrate including an insulating substrate, a signal line, a first organic insulating film located above the signal line, a metal line located above the first organic insulating film, an insulator stacked on the metal line, a second organic insulating film which covers the insulator, a common electrode located above the second organic insulating film, and a pixel electrode opposed to the common electrode; a second substrate opposed to the first substrate; and a liquid crystal layer held between the first substrate and the second substrate, wherein the metal line is in contact with the first organic insulating film; the insulator is not in contact with the first organic insulating film; and the second organic insulating film is in contact with each of the metal line, the insulator, and the first organic insulating film. - View Dependent Claims (16, 17, 18)
